Fmr. Miami-Dade Mayor Carlos Alvarez Is Ripped

MIAMI (CBSMiami) – At one time he was one of the most powerful men in Miami-Dade County.

During his seven and a half year career as mayor, Carlos Alvarez was responsible the county's 2.4 million residents. It all came to an end in March, 2011 when he was ousted from office in a recall vote.

Now Alvarez is taking his pursuits to another level of a very different type of stage – a stage that former California governor Arnold Schwarzenegger was most comfortable on.

Alvarez has been hitting the gym and getting ripped, according to the Miami New Times.

Alvarez, 60, competed last November in the National Physique Competition South Florida body building tournament and won two of the categories including the Masters 60-plus Heavyweight competition.

Alvarez is reportedly maintaining his gym work so he can compete in another body building competition this summer.

The Miami New Times contributed to this report.
